A marble (dimension) deposit/quarry located in sec. 14, T2N, R14E, MDM, 0.3 km (1,100 feet) WSW of Columbia proper (quarry is 5 miles by paved highway N of Sierra Railway in Sonora; in lot 18, Columbia Township). MRDS database accuracy for this location is not stated.
Mineralization is a metamorphic marble deposit. Local rocks include limestone of probable Paleozoic or Mesozoic age.
Workings include surface openings (presumably quarry operations).
